sugarplum892 Posted June 22, 2015 Share Posted June 22, 2015 (edited) Details:Title: 华胥引 / Huá xū yǐnEnglish title: City of Hopeless LoveGenre: Action, Fiction, Love, PeriodDirector: Lǐ DáchāoEpisodes: 48Broadcast Date: July 9, 2015 - July, 2015Cast:Kevin CheungGan TingtingYuan HongJiang XinGuo ZhenniSynopsis:Ye Zhen, princess of a fallen country, is resurrected by a magic pearl. She adopts the alias of Jun Fu, and wanders around the nine provinces, weaving dreams for people with the Hua Xu tune. On her adventures, she meets Mu Yan, and develops romantic affections for him. Jun Fu does not know until later that Mu Yan is actually Su Yu, crown prince of the Chen Kingdom, and had disappeared from home to avoid fighting with half-brother Su Xie for the throne.
